Wireless terminal and wireless communication method
First Claim
1. A wireless terminal constituting an ad-hoc network to perform communication, comprising:
- a frame transmitter to transmit a data frame wirelessly, the data frame containing a frame identifier and a variable that is to be modified according to a predetermined rule when the data frame directly received by a first subsequent wireless terminal is forwarded from the first subsequent wireless terminal to a second subsequent wireless terminal, as well as when the data frame is forwarded from the second subsequent wireless terminal to yet another subsequent wireless terminal;
a memory to store a record of the variable at the time of transmission of the data frame by the frame transmitter;
a frame receiver to receive a data frame wirelessly transmitted from one of the first and second subsequent wireless terminals which have forwarded the data frame originally transmitted by the frame transmitter, the received data frame having the same frame identifier as the data frame transmitted by the frame transmitter; and
a frame reception recognizer to recognize that the first subsequent wireless terminal has received the data frame transmitted by the frame transmitter, when a difference between the variable contained in the received data frame and the variable stored in the memory is one, and that the second subsequent wireless terminal has received the data frame transmitted by the transmitting, when the difference between the variable contained in the received data frame and the variable stored in the memory is two.

Abstract
A wireless terminal and wireless communication method that can improve data transfer efficiency and reduce traffic. A frame transmitter of a wireless terminal transmits a frame by wireless. A wireless terminal receives the frame transmitted from the frame transmitter and transmits the received frame by wireless to a wireless terminal. A frame receiver receives the frame transmitted from the succeeding wireless terminal to the wireless terminal. When the frame is received by the frame receiver, a frame reception recognizer recognizes that the frame has been received by the succeeding wireless terminal. It is therefore unnecessary for the wireless terminal to receive, from the succeeding wireless terminal, a frame indicative of reception of the frame, so that the data transfer efficiency improves and the traffic reduces.
